Introduction
The Telegraph, officially known as the Daily Telegraph, is one of the UK’s most influential newspapers, providing comprehensive news coverage, analysis, and commentary across various sectors, including politics, economy, culture, and sports. Established in 1855, The Telegraph has consistently played a significant role in shaping public discourse and informing readers on critical issues. Its relevance extends beyond mere reporting, as it often influences opinions and decisions across the country.
